Chatham-Kent Police Service officials allege: A 44-year-old Blenheim resident is facing multiple charges after an early morning incident involving a vehicle on Little Street North.
Chatham-Kent police say an officer observed a suspicious individual in a vehicle with the driver’s door open at about 6:24 a.m. on March 25, 2026.
When approached, the individual identified himself but attempted to flee before being quickly apprehended.
Police allege the individual had unlawfully entered the vehicle and disturbed items inside. Officers also determined the accused was bound by conditions not to enter any motor vehicle without permission.
The individual has been charged with attempted theft and two counts of failure to comply with a release order.
The accused was transported to the South West Detention Centre and remanded in custody pending a video court appearance scheduled for April 2, 2026.
